two.2.4) Description of the procurement

Sheffield City Council, Children Young People and Families is looking for a Service Provider to deliver an Appropriate Adult Service to Children and Vulnerable Adults, within the requirements of the National Standards for Youth Justice Services 2019. To reduce offending and re-offending of Children and Vulnerable Adults in Sheffield, Doncaster, Barnsley, and Rotherham through a number of complementary Services, strategies both locally and nationally, and in accordance with National Standards. The Service Provider shall ensure that each above named Local Authority Police Station has 24-hour access to a pool of trained Appropriate Adults with the ability to meet the diverse needs of all Service Users. The Service Provider shall ensure that provision includes sufficient capacity on weekdays, weekends, daytime and overnight for 365 days per year for both children and vulnerable adults and ensure that Appropriate Adults are identified and able to attend within a maximum of one hour of being requested by the Police to attend.
